Expoint - all jobs in one place

The point where experts and best companies meet

Limitless High-tech career opportunities - Expoint

Microsoft Principal Software Engineer-Xbox 
Costa Rica, San José 
380960625

10.09.2024

Would you like to be at the forefront of Gamingand AI,to design and build productsthat will transform and accelerate how games are made

s thebuild developer tools and services that enable game creators to craft incredible experiences.empowering creators of all sizesto masterthe challenges of today and the emerging technologies of tomorrowa great rolefor you.

n amazingus in the Xbox Developer orgdesign andcraft the build, test, and flightsolutions, boosted by AI,that will powergame constructionou willbe responsible forinnovation and excellence in software developmentby example andwill play a pivotal role intechnology andan effective foundation in cloud, automation,developer tools, we encourage you to apply.

At Xbox,committed to inclusivity and diversity. Even if youmeet allthe qualificationslisted, we welcome your application. Your unique perspective and potential contributions are highly valued here


Qualifications

Qualifications:

  • Bachelor's Degree in Computer Science, or related technical discipline AND 4+ years technical engineering experience or equivalent experience.
  • 10+ years of experience building production-level systems
  • Experience withbuildingand managingservicesandsoftwarethat runs efficiently on-premisesandin the cloudusingC#, scripting languages,andcloud services
  • Knowledge of front-end development and componentization
  • Demonstratedstrengthsin communication, problem-solving, design, and execution
  • Ability to lead through example and influence
  • Experience in building new products or features from the ground up
  • Proficiencyin DevOps practices and related tools
  • Ability to thrive in a dynamic, fast-paced work environment

Preferred Qualifications:

  • ience with the game development industry and game studio workflows
  • Familiar with AI/ML concepts and technologies


Responsibilities
  • technical ownership as partof a team of product-focused software developers
  • Work effectively across organizational, time zone, and geographic boundaries
  • Drive scalablesolutionsthat accelerate game development
  • Work acrossclient, services,design, andproduct management teams to ensure successful customer-centric solutions
  • Craft clean, efficient, and maintainable code across a range of technologies
  • Ensure design, implementation, and operation of products and features have a focus on modularity,componentreuse, performance, and reliability
  • Drive for quality in everything you do and continuously improve the systems on which you work
  • Give and receive feedbackin the spirit of continual growth and improvement
  • Contribute to an inclusive, creative, high-performance team culture